

It’s the same with calico cats as well from what I understand, almost all are female.
Yep, to get calico coloring, cats must have two X chromosomes, so they will be female. If a male calico is born, it will be XXY. So that’s a rare mutation to encounter, and those cats are always sterile too, so they’re not passing along their mutation to any kittens either.
